The function of the steam drum is to receive water from the economizer, perform steam-water separation and supply water to the circulation loop, and deliver saturated steam to the superheater. Below are specific details about the steam drum: 1. Structure: The steam drum contains a certain amount of water, storing a certain level of heat and working medium. During operational changes, it helps slow down the rate of steam pressure variation and provides a buffer effect when there is a short-term imbalance between water supply and load. The steam drum is equipped with internal devices to perform steam-water separation, steam washing, in-boiler chemical dosing, and continuous blowdown to ensure steam quality. 2. Operational Conditions: The steam drum is the heaviest and most expensive thick-walled pressure-bearing component in a boiler. During boiler startup and shutdown, temperature differences between the upper and lower walls, as well as between the inner and outer walls of the steam drum, generate thermal stress. Particularly in high-parameter boilers, where the drum walls are very thick, the steam drum often becomes the main component limiting the startup speed. Therefore, it is essential to measure and closely monitor the temperature differences between the inner and outer walls and the upper and lower walls of the steam drum.

I've studied airbag systems, and the entire process from collision to deployment is ultra-precise. The sensors at the front of the car act like keen eyes, detecting deceleration the moment an impact occurs. This signal is transmitted to the control module, which immediately activates the gas generator if preset parameters are met. I've disassembled airbags from scrapped cars—inside, special nylon fabric is folded, and when the igniter burns, nitrogen fills it instantly. After inflation, the fabric's pores gradually release the gas to prevent rebound injuries. Modern high-end cars feature dual-stage airbags: minor collisions trigger a softer deployment, while severe crashes activate full-force inflation. When repairing cars, I often work with airbag systems, which consist of three core components. The crash sensors act like detectives distributed across different parts of the vehicle body. The control module serves as the system's brain, equipped with built-in accelerometers and processing chips. The gas generator is the most ingenious part, using sodium azide to produce a large volume of harmless nitrogen gas. The airbag itself is made of silicone-coated nylon and is folded beneath the central cover of the steering wheel. The clock spring in the wiring system ensures uninterrupted electrical connections during steering wheel rotation. The entire system is protected by a 15-amp fuse. During inspections, I use diagnostic tools to read fault codes—sometimes a loose connector triggers the warning light, and disconnecting the battery for ten minutes can resolve temporary faults.

When I first started driving, the instructor repeatedly reminded me about the key points of airbag usage. First, you must fasten your seatbelt tightly, otherwise the impact force when the airbag deploys could break ribs. I'm used to adjusting the seat to a position where my arms are slightly bent, keeping a safe distance of 25 centimeters from the steering wheel. Child safety seats must be securely fixed in the back seat, as the front airbag deployment zone is particularly dangerous for a child's head and neck. Never stick a phone mount in the airbag area, as it can turn into a projectile when the airbag deploys. Always take a quick glance at the airbag indicator light on the dashboard when starting the car—it should light up for three seconds and then turn off. As early as the 1970s, people were experimenting with airbag devices in cars, and Mercedes-Benz was the first to equip them in the 1980s. In 1998, my old Ford didn't even have a passenger airbag, but now even a 100,000-yuan car comes standard with six airbags. The first-generation airbags deployed with too much force, easily causing fractures in children and shorter individuals, so after 2003, dual-stage inflation technology was introduced. Nowadays, even seat belts come with integrated airbags, and Volvo's new design can firmly press occupants into their seats. Airbag technology continues to evolve—Lexus has an external airbag that deploys from under the car during a collision to lift the body and reduce impact. What is the equivalent displacement of a 1.5T engine?

1.5T is roughly equivalent to 2.0L. There is currently no precise calculation standard for turbocharged displacement conversion, as many factors such as vehicle model differences and manufacturer settings affect the displacement. Generally, the power output of a turbocharged engine can reach about 1.3 to 1.5 times that of a naturally aspirated engine of the same displacement, so a 1.5T engine is approximately equivalent to a 2.0L displacement. Additional information about turbochargers: 1. Function: To increase the engine's air intake, thereby enhancing its power and torque, making the vehicle more powerful. 2. Working Principle: The turbocharger uses the exhaust gases from the engine's exhaust outlet to drive the turbine wheel in the turbine housing. The turbine wheel is directly connected to the compressor wheel in the compressor housing. One end of the compressor housing is connected to the air filter, while the other end compresses the air drawn from the filter into the engine's cylinders, increasing the amount of air in the engine.

If one ignition coil is bad, do all four need to be replaced?

If one ignition coil is bad and the four coils are not connected together, only the faulty one needs to be replaced. However, if the four coils are interconnected, all four must be replaced. The ignition coil, also known as the high-voltage pack, is part of the car engine's ignition system. Typically, one ignition coil is responsible for firing one cylinder, though some may handle two. If an ignition coil fails, the corresponding cylinder will stop working, leading to noticeable symptoms such as poor acceleration and engine vibration. If only one ignition coil is faulty while the others are functioning normally, the car may still be drivable in an emergency, but prolonged use can be harmful to the engine, mounts, and connecting components. It is advisable to visit a repair shop as soon as possible for inspection and maintenance.

What is lovol excavator?

lovol excavator is manufactured by Foton Lovol International Heavy Industry Co., Ltd., which is a large industrial equipment manufacturing enterprise mainly engaged in construction machinery, agricultural equipment, and vehicles. Excavator, also known as digging machinery or power shovel, is an earthmoving machine that uses a bucket to dig materials above or below the bearing surface and load them into transport vehicles or unload them to stockyards. The materials excavated by the excavator are mainly soil, coal, sediment, and pre-loosened soil and rocks. The development of excavators has been relatively rapid, and excavators have become one of the main construction machinery in engineering construction. The three important parameters of an excavator are: operating weight (mass), engine power, and bucket capacity.
